Next-generation firewall for enterprises

WatchGuard is now shipping the WatchGuard XTM 2050, a next-generation firewall (NGFW) that provides enterprise-class security for large enterprises and data centers that require high-performance firewall, application control and IPS to protect against data theft, malware and security breaches.

The XTM 2050 provides line-speed security inspection on all traffic, supports multi-gigabit packet filtering throughput and provides application control. It connects offices via unique Drag and Drop VPN; connects people via SSL and IPSec VPN; and gives the enterprise unparalleled visibility into real-time and historical user, network and security activities.

Key Features and specifications:

  • 20 Gbps firewall, and up to 10Gbps full content inspection
  • High port density with 16 1GB copper ports and 2 10 GB SFP+ Fiber ports
  • Port Independence: any port can be External, Trusted, or DMZ
  • Redundant hot-swap power supplies, fans, storage, and NICs
  • High Availability (active/passive and active/active)
  • WAN and VPN failover
  • Application Control for over 1,800 applications
  • Integration with Active Directory, LDAP, RADIUS, and other authentication sources for user-based firewalling
  • New and powerful management, reporting, monitoring, logging capabilities
  • IPSec site to site and remote user VPN
  • SSL remote user VPN
  • Advanced VoIP and HTTPS security
  • Extensive traffic shaping, QoS and bandwidth control
  • Secure connectivity for Apple iPad, iPhone and iPod touch devices
  • IPv6 Ready Gold Logo Certified (Routing).

Malicious activity can run amok on corporate networks if both network traffic and/or systems activities are not monitored. IPS works in tandem with the application layer content inspection to provide real-time protection against network threats, including spyware, SQL injections, cross-site scripting, and buffer overflows. IPS scans tra­ffic on all major protocols, using continually updated signatures to detect and block all types of threats.
